Orangey, a male orange tabby, was a prolific animal actor, and was at least one of the cats that played “Cat” in the iconic Audrey Hepburn film. Orangey has won the Patsy Award (the top animal acting award) twice. Hepburn’s character, Holly Golightly, infamously throws the furry feline out of a cab and into the pouring rain, and uses him to describe her identity as this: “I'm like Cat here, a no-name slob. We belong to nobody, and nobody belongs to us. We don't even belong to each other.”
